Afterschool / Expanded Learning Opportunities Program (ELOP)

Make the Most of
After School

In partnership with local schools, the YMCA offers Expanded Learning Opportunities Program (ELOP), where your child will experience a safe, enriching, and engaging environment before and after school—right on their school campus and at no cost.

What to Expect

Designed for TK through 8th grade students, our ELOP program offers free, high-quality programming that supports student achievement in the areas of academics, enrichment and recreation. Whether it’s help with homework, a hands-on science project, a group game on the playground, or a creative art activity, your child will be supported by caring and trained YMCA staff who are committed to helping them thrive and expand their learning.

As a parent, you can expect a program that runs every school day and aligns with your school’s bell schedule. Our activities are designed to foster achievement, strengthen relationships, and promote a sense of belonging for every student. Because the program takes place on your child’s school campus and is offered at no cost to families, participation is both convenient and accessible. If your child attends the hosting school, they are eligible to enroll and be part of a positive, structured, and nurturing YMCA program that extends learning beyond the classroom.

Who Can Join

This program is funded by the State of California Expanded Learning Opportunities Program (ELOP) for students TK-8th grade and eligibility varies by school and school district.

Pricing

This program is free and open to eligible students at the host school.
